Meeting Ink and Subanana are both AI meeting assistants for recording, transcription, and summaries, compared here on pricing, features, and workflow fit. Meeting Ink: Taiwan-built AI meeting assistant that transcribes and summarizes online and in-person meetings, with strong Traditional Chinese, Taiwanese, and Hakka support. Subanana: Hong Kong AI transcription and subtitling platform with meeting transcription, summaries, and multilingual support. Pros & cons
Meeting Ink
+ Strong support for Taiwanese and Hakka dialects that most global tools lack
+ Works across many platforms including web, mobile, desktop, and a Chrome extension
- Localization and dialect strengths are most relevant to Traditional Chinese markets
Subanana
+ Built for the Hong Kong market with strong Cantonese and code-switching support
+ Covers both subtitling/content workflows and meeting transcription
- Free allowance is limited before requiring a paid plan
